Loha Bhasma is also pronounced as Louh Bhasma. It contains micro-fine iron particles prepared by calcination under high temperatures. It is used to treat problems caused due to iron deficiency like anemia[1]. It also shows strength promoting and anti-aging properties. According to some researchers, it also acts as an effective remedy for chronic fever and breathlessness.
According to Ayurveda, Loha Bhasma helps reduce anemia due to its pitta balancing property. It is high in iron which helps with anemia and improves general weakness. Loha Bhasma contains Vrishya (aphrodisiac) and Balya (strength provider) properties which may aid in improving libido, thereby helping improve male sexual dysfunction and stamina.
Loha Bhasma is available in powder form. Loha Bhasma is generally given in combination with other ayurvedic medicines in the form of a mixture. The mixture is usually advised to be taken with Ghee or Honey to get rid of problems like anemia. Avoid self-medication or taking Loha Bhasma in excess.
Patients with gastritis or other digestion-related problems should consult a doctor before taking it. This is because Loha Bhasma is Guru (heavy) in nature and may cause symptoms like flatulence or constipation.
Loha Bhasma is generally well tolerated and does not have any side effects when taken in the recommended dose. However, it is advisable to consult the doctor before using Loha Bhasma.
